hpicfDhcpSnoopOpt82Insert

Module: HP-ICF-DHCP-SNOOP-MIB

OID (symbolic): HP-ICF-DHCP-SNOOP-MIB::hpicfDhcpSnoopOpt82Insert

OID (numeric): 1.3.6.1.4.1.11.2.14.11.5.1.34.1.1.1.7

Node type: OBJECT-TYPE

Type: TruthValue

Access: read-write

Description: When this object is set to true, DHCP snooping will add a DHCP relay information option to DHCP client packets that it forwards on trusted ports, and will examine and strip DHCP relay information options that were inserted by this switch on DHCP server packets that it forwards to untrusted ports. Note that when DHCP relay and DHCP snooping are both enabled, and this object is set to true, relay information option processing will be handled by DHCP snooping, and any DHCP relay settings for relay information option processing will be ignored. This object defaults to true.

What is hpicfDhcpSnoopOpt82Insert?

When true (the default), DHCP Snooping inserts Option 82 relay information into client packets forwarded out trusted ports, and strips relay information it previously added from server packets going back to untrusted ports. Admins set this false only if they want a downstream relay agent or DHCP server to fully own Option 82 handling instead of the switch.
